Here is a snapshot of our Q4 and full year 2020 results, and our 2021 plan: Q4 2020 revenue was down only 22% year-over-year, demonstrating Airbnb’s resilience. At the depth of the pandemic, we forecasted our 2020 revenue could be less than half of what it was in 2019. Yet in the end, total revenue of $3.4 billion for 2020 decreased only 30% ...

Feb 8, 2017 · But Airbnb guests spend between about $90 and $120 per night for an Uptown apartment on a weeknight, and between $60 and $80 in Plaza Midwood. South End is pricier, generally between $100 and $200 per night. Add about $50 to $75 per night for the weekend. Average occupancy can range from 40 percent to 70 percent, according to AIRDNA. They pay the landlord a fixed monthly rent and aim to ...Schedule C Example: Let’s say you make $20,000 net profit from your Airbnb in 2021. If you’re in a 20% income tax bracket, you will have to pay a total of $7,060 in tax. (20% income tax + 15.3% self-employment tax = 35.3% total tax rate times $20K). Guests are staying longer, even living on Airbnb. While short-term stays rebounded strongly in Q1 2022, long-term stays of 28 days or more continue to be our fastest-growing category by trip length compared to 2019.
